Creating a Sankey Chart
-
Understanding the Data: The first step in creating a Sankey chart is to have a clear understanding of the data flow. You need to identify the inputs, outputs, and the magnitude of each flow value. This is essential for assigning the appropriate weights to each link.
-
Visualizing the Structure: The key elements in a Sankey chart are the source (起点), target (终点), and the link (pipes) connecting them. The sources and targets should be labeled clearly, and the links should have the right thickness and color to convey the flow amount.
-
Choosing the Right Software: There are various tools and software options for creating Sankey charts, such as Tableau, D3.js, Excel, and dedicated graphing applications. Choose the one that best fits your data and visualization needs.
-
Styling for Clarity: Make sure to use colors and shading to emphasize the flow direction and strength. Using a gradient or unique patterns for the links can also make the chart more visually appealing and less cluttered.
Applications of Sankey Charts
-
Process Analysis: They are perfect for industries like manufacturing, logistics, and supply chains, where understanding the flow of resources and materials is crucial. Sankey charts can help identify bottlenecks, inefficiencies, and potential improvements.
-
Economic Analysis: In econometrics, Sankey charts are used to represent trade flows, migration patterns, and financial transactions. By visualizing the movement of capital, goods, or people, policymakers can make informed decisions.
-
Energy and Environment: Sankey charts can display energy consumption patterns, carbon footprints, and infrastructure flows, helping industries and governments track their environmental impact.
-
Education: Educational applications, such as science demonstrations or understanding systems like the water cycle, can use Sankey charts to illustrate the conversion of resources in a clear and engaging manner.
-
Information Visualization: In news or reports, Sankey charts can be used to illustrate the flow of information, from the source to the recipient, in a visual and clear format.
